**Q: How can I conduct user research using AI participants?**
A: Conduct user research using AI participants by following these steps: 1. Define your research goals and select the appropriate interview type such as Problem Exploration or Concept Testing. 2. Use AI-powered synthetic users that simulate human-like behaviors and interactions based on advanced AI architectures. 3. Customize your research by uploading proprietary data to enrich synthetic users for more specific insights. 4. Run interviews or surveys at scale using multi-agent frameworks to gather qualitative and quantitative data. 5. Analyze the generated insights and share annotated reports with your team to inform decision-making.

**Q: How do synthetic users differ from traditional AI chatbots in research?**
A: Understand the differences between synthetic users and traditional AI chatbots by following these steps: 1. Synthetic users are powered by multi-agent architectures where multiple AI agents interact to simulate complex human behaviors, unlike single-agent chatbots. 2. They maintain contextual continuity across multiple interactions, enabling simulation of long-term behaviors and relationships. 3. Synthetic users integrate various foundation models and proprietary data to enhance diversity and specificity. 4. They provide richer qualitative and quantitative insights by alternating between interviews and surveys. 5. Traditional chatbots typically respond to isolated queries without dynamic interaction or evolving behavior.
